Abstract

The utility model relates to an electronic proportion alarming burglary-prevention device, the mechanical parts of which consist of a magnetor, a trigger, an igniter, a high-voltage ignition coil, an NC555 control chip, a diode, a speaker, a switch, an electronic scale, a plug and a 12 V storage battery, and is characterized in that a blue wire of the electronic proportion alarming burglary-prevention device is connected with the trigger, and a white wire of the electronic proportion alarming burglary-prevention device is connected with the igniter, and a grey wire and a brown wire are led out to form a circuit with the NC555 control chip after being connected with the plug and the electronic scale. When the switch is connected, if the NC555 control chip is free from sensing the trigger signal of the electronic scale and the time exceeds the setup value of the NC555 control chip, NC555 control chip conveys the electric power of the storage battery to the speaker through an orange wire and a yellow wire so as to control the alarming of the speaker; at the same time, the blue wire and the white wire are disconnected, so that the engine cannot be started up, thereby realizing the control function of the burglary-prevention alarming.

Technical field
The utility model relates to a kind of anti-theft system of self-propelled vehicle, is a kind of electronics proportion alarm anti-theft concretely.
Background technology
At present, motor bike generally adopts remote annunciator to be used as the overwhelming majority that accounted for of anti-joyride device, this mechanism simple structure, easy to maintenance, but there is obvious weak point: because there is flase alarm in remote annunciator, annunciator main frame power consumption during vehicle immobilization is because of flase alarm and main frame power consumption cause the vehicle battery power consumption to cause that totally vehicle can not start.
The utility model content
The purpose of this utility model is to provide a kind of electronics proportion alarm anti-theft, make and guaranteeing on the simply constructed basis of former anti-theft system, also have the elimination flase alarm, the not power consumption of vehicle immobilization main frame can be used as the electronics proportion alarm anti-theft of the anti-theft system of motor bike.
The utility model is realized with following technical scheme: this electronics proportion alarm anti-theft mainly is made up of magneto generator, binary pair, firing unit, high-voltage ignition coil, NC555 control chip, diode, loud speaker, switch, electronic scales, plug, 12V storage battery.At first the blue line with electronics proportion alarm anti-theft is connected with binary pair, the white wire of electronics proportion alarm anti-theft is connected with firing unit, the electric energy of 12V storage battery is supplied electric energy by red line and green line to electronics proportion alarm anti-theft under the situation of switch conduction, grey lines derives with the brown line and forms plug is connected back and NC555 with electronic scales control chip formation loop, blue line and white wire conducting, magneto generator rotation behind the engine starting, the energizing signal that binary pair produces offers electronics proportion alarm anti-theft in-to-in NC555 control chip, the NC555 control chip is transported to the inside of firing unit by white wire, to realize the igniting of high-voltage ignition coil; Behind switch conduction, the NC555 control chip does not perceive the energizing signal of electronic scales and time and surpasses the setting value of NC555 control chip, NC555 will be transported to loud speaker to the electric energy of storage battery by orange line and yellow line, thereby blue line of the warning of control loudspeaker while and white wire will be disconnected, driving engine can not start, and has realized the controllable function of anti-theft alarm.
Compared with the prior art, use electronics proportion alarm anti-theft can solve the flase alarm of remote annunciator, vehicle does not have drawbacks such as the remote annunciator of startup main frame power consumption.
In sum, just because of this electronics proportion alarm anti-theft has the flase alarm that solves remote annunciator, vehicle does not have the power consumption of the remote annunciator of startup main frame, the storage battery power consumption function totally that causes, thereby the service life of improving the warning accuracy rate and the prolongation storage battery of electronics proportion alarm anti-theft.
